I'm Linda and I get texts from Hometalk on Facebook too. Here's what I did so that I don't get things during the night. There should be a setting on your phone where you can set it for "quiet time". I have mine set so that I don't get text's between 11:00 PM and 8:00 AM. It works like a charm. I think you might find it in your privacy settings, but every phone is different. Check all of the setting, including "Advanced settings" (don't change anything though) or if you still can't find it, use your search feature. Use words like ' find privacy setting on samsung phone ' . It would also help to include your model in that search feature. I hope this helps you.
